Abstract:
Building undergo torsional excilations during an earthquake. But torsional earthquake input is not clear in building design by now. To estimate the torsional input of structures caused by earthquake, a simplified method is presented. The torsional ground motion, the torsional foundation input and their differences are discussed. It shows that the ratio of foundation length to the apparent earthquake wavelength and the ratio of foundation length to width affect the difference. A formula of torsional earthquake input of a structure is suggested for engineering structure purpose.
